Edgard Heirman, Moerbeke 1919-2002.
Heirman pigeon clock / constateur.
The removable movement is placed in a fibre reinforced Bakelite case.
The precision movement is a National Watch, N.R. de Scheemacher, Natural, Antwerp, Heirman Breveté.
The properly running movement is numbered 567, the Bakelite case has the same number.
A brass winding key. Also present is the paper roll on which the flight arrivals were printed when the rubber ring was removed from the pigeon's leg, put in the device and turned with the large winding key.
Can also be used as a regular clock.
